The default (if SQLSetConnectAttr is not called to set the SQL_ODBC_CURSORS attribute) is SQL_CUR_USE_DRIVER which means to use cursors in the ODBC driver (if you need cursors and the driver does You are currently viewing LQ as a guest. Here's a quick example problem as it manifests on the CLI… bmy / # isql -v gupta1 newengland clamchowda +---------------------------------------+ | Connected! | | | | sql-statement | | help [tablename] DBIx::Log4perl lets you selectively log your application's DBI activity.PHPEnabling ODBC support in PHP under Apache Connecting to ODBC data sources from Apache/PHP.Accessing Microsoft SQL Server from PHP under Apache on UNIX Source
Tutorial and examples.Perl DBI - Put Your Data On The Web Using Perl CGI scripts to publish your data on the web.Debugging Perl DBI Avoid errors by following our Perl DBI e.g. e.g.: SQL> select * from table_does_not_exist [S0002][unixODBC][Microsoft][ODBC SQL Server Driver][SQL Server] Invalid object name 'table_does_not_exist'. [unixODBC][Microsoft][ODBC SQL Server Driver][SQL Server] Statement(s) could not be prepared. [ISQL]ERROR: Could not SQLExecute SQL> If What are cell phone lots at US airports for?
With my current solution, this minor change affects almost every file in the repo; so I am trying to find something a bit more creative. Jens K. USER data sources are defined in a users home directory in the file (.odbc.ini) and are only readable by that user (dependent on the value of your umask at the time
edit - I found the following looks like it's not allowed? D.) The closest I've come to finding a similar error (well result I guess) to what osql spit out is here. new SQLBindParameter replacing SQLSetParam) core, level 1 and 2 conformance changes, new data types. Isql Linux Example You should probably also set --with-x.
What does a data source look like? [im002][unixodbc][driver Manager]data Source Name Not Found, And No Default Driver Specified When enabled, UTF-8 encoded data sent to MS SQL Server is converted to UCS-2 and returned data is converted from UCS-2 to UTF-8. In the odbcinst.ini file the section defining a driver begins with the driver name in [ ]. Thanks, Tom Tuesday, May 08, 2007 4:21 PM Reply | Quote 0 Sign in to vote Hello, I was able to change the Database State to NORMAL (I changed the
unixODBC also has a sourceforge project at sourceforge.net/projects/unixodbc. Test Odbc Connection Linux DMConnAttr and DMStmtAttr These unixODBC specific data source attributes work like DMEnvAttr (above). Installers might also link to this library to use SQLInstallDriver APIs.libodbccr.so - the ODBC cursor librarydltest - a binary to check for the existence of shared object entry pointsisql - a I just created a new login/user (SQL Authentication) and when I try to login, it errors out: [S0001][unixODBC][Easysoft][ODBC SQL Server Driver][SQL Server]Login failed for user 'test1' I believe the error is
A file DSN definition is basically the same as above (in the user and system ini files) except it is a file containing a single data source and the data source Could structural loads be a problem for Air India Flight 173? Unixodbc Isql Are you new to LinuxQuestions.org? [isql]error: Could Not Sqlconnect Vertical alignment of tikz circle in equation Were students "forced to recite 'Allah is the only God'" in Tennessee public schools? 2002 research: speed of light slowing down?
odbcinst -f template_file -d -i In this case your template file must contain the Driver and Description attributes at a minimum and optionally the Setup attribute e.g. [DRIVER_NAME] Description = description Word for destroying someone's heart physically Farming after the apocalypse: chickens or giant cockroaches? I figured just in case someone was mis-informing me I tried some MySQL commands there as well. There are three methods of installing an ODBC driver under unixODBC: You write a program which links with libodbcinst.so and calls SQLInstallDriver. Linux Odbc Driver
However, ODBC also includes: A cursor library (see What does the cursor library do?) Utilities and APIs to install, remove and query installed drivers. Contact Us - Advertising Info - Rules - LQ Merchandise - Donations - Contributing Member - LQ Sitemap - Main Menu Linux Forum Android Forum Chrome OS Forum Search LQ If you build with iconv and access then unixODBC can do Unicode translations. http://rsmasters.net/could-not/isql-error-could-not-sql-prepare.html For instance, you may want to access an MS Access database from Java, but there is no Microsoft JDBC driver for MS Access.
If a driver does this it does not matter where SYSTEM or USER DSNs are defined, as unixODBC knows where to look for them and what the format of the odbc.ini Unixodbc Test Connection If the SQLExecute fails (or returns SQL_SUCCESS_WITH_INFO), isql will use SQLError to obtain ODBC diagnostics. Related 6FreeTDS - tsql connects, isql fails0Only able to issue one sql statement from isql13FreeTDS working, but ODBC cannot connect2FreeTDS unixODBC concurrent connections3Connect to MS SQL database using freetds, unixodbc and
Be careful when running ODBC applications as different users and tracing because most users will set their umask such that other users cannot write to newly created files. Drivers which know about the unixODBC driver manager use the ODBC API SQLGetPrivateProfileString() to obtain DSN attributes. Is it possible to keep publishing under my professional (maiden) name, different from my married legal name? Unixodbc Install Any unauthorized review, use, disclosure or distribution is prohibited.
The ODBC-JDBC gateway is installed on the same machine as your application, and depending on how the gateway was written you:Install Java and the JDBC driver on the same machine, and Few ODBC drivers for UNIX have a setup dialogue. If you want to use WIndows authentication you will have to be aware that you cannot explicitly pass a user name within the connectionstring, the username is passed implicitly through Windows. Check This Out A common error with Apache is to define a user DSN in the .odbc.ini file in user FRED’s account then run Apache under the nobody account.
Thanks, Errick Coughlin Developer - ETL Group Kroger IS&S Technology Enablement BTC Grooms ES-283 Office: (513) 387-7576 Mobile: (513) 582-2973 From: Coughlin, Errick R Sent: Monday, October 07, 2013 more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ed There are now a large number of commercial and Open Source drivers available for Linux/UNIX.ODBC Driver Managers There are two open source ODBC driver managers for UNIX (unixODBC and iODBC). If it does not fill the buffer then it contradicts the ODBC specification and if it does you cannot use your data until you have retrieved all of it.Drivers supporting UTF-8
Join them; it only takes a minute: Sign up Resolving database connection errors like this: [ISQL]ERROR: Could not SQLConnect up vote 3 down vote favorite What does this error typically mean? How to find positive things in a code review? The cursor library is a shared object called libodbccr.so which will exist in the lib subdirectory of wherever you set --prefix to when you build/configure unixODBC. Includes QODBC code sample.OpenOffice.orgAccessing ODBC Databases from OpenOffice.org Connecting to ODBC data sources from OOo applications such as Base, Calc and Writer.StarOfficeAccessing ODBC Databases from StarOffice 8 Connecting to ODBC data
What happens when (from the bin directory) you run "odbcinst -q -d" -- does it list your datasource? –Hambone Jul 18 '14 at 13:40 @Hambone would you mind looking